    Program Analyst – Wisconsin Court System, Children’s Court Improvement Program
    If you want to make a difference in the lives of children and families involved in the courts and you have legal or policy experience related to child welfare or youth justice, we encourage you to apply for the Program Analyst position at the Wisconsin Court System.

    The Program Analyst for the Children’s Court Improvement Program provides complex analysis and recommendations on policy, procedural, and legal issues related to the court processing of child in need of protection or services (CHIPS) and termination of parent rights (TPR) cases. The program analyst also collects and analyzes qualitative and quantitative data to assess compliance with outcome measures and program requirements; provides technical assistance to circuit courts; and advises and provides staff support to various internal and external committees.
